Plan the Event Details Before You Book

Start by clarifying the type of gathering you’re hosting, since that determines the best truck setup and service style. Backyard parties, school fundraisers, and neighborhood block events each have different space needs and guest flow. This planning makes it much easier to match your group size with the right ice cream truck and staffing level.

Next, review the location and logistics where the truck will park. Check for clear access for the vehicle, a safe turnaround area, and enough room for guests to line up without crowding driveways or walkways. If you’re serving near a street, coordinate with anyone managing parking or traffic control so the truck can arrive and stay safely. For indoor venues, confirm whether the truck can set up near the entrance or if you’ll need an alternate plan for service flow.

Choose the Right Options for Your Guests

When you’re comparing rental packages, focus on what guests will actually experience during the event. Ask about variety, portion options, and how substitutions are handled so you can accommodate common preferences and dietary needs. You’ll also want to confirm whether the service is designed for quick lines, ticketed servings, or a more relaxed walk-up approach.

Don’t overlook the “small stuff” that can make the event feel polished. Consider whether you’ll need napkins, cups, utensils, or additional signage to keep ordering smooth. If you want themed touches—like fun toppings stations, celebration-friendly presentation, or branded coordination—ask early so the truck can align with your setup. For larger gatherings, it’s helpful to map where guests will wait, where they’ll order, and where they’ll enjoy their treats, so lines move comfortably.

Budget Smart and Avoid Common Booking Mistakes

To stay on budget, request a clear breakdown of pricing and what’s included in the rental. Compare base rental costs alongside service staffing, travel considerations, and any minimums tied to guest count. Some events benefit from longer service windows if you expect staggered arrivals, while others can run efficiently with a shorter block. A practical approach is to select a serving duration that matches your schedule rather than guessing and ending early or stretching too long.

One common mistake is booking without confirming the arrival and service window expectations. Ask how far in advance the truck needs to position on-site and what happens if weather affects the event layout. If your venue has strict rules for noise, parking, or generator use, share those requirements before finalizing. Another helpful step is to verify the payment process and any deposits so you’re not surprised by timing or administrative requirements.
